Thirty-four years have passed since Sylvester Stallone and Dolph Lundgren faced off in Rocky IV. The film catapulted both actors to stardom, but their initial encounter was far from friendly. In a recent appearance on The Tonight Show, Stallone revealed that he hated Lundgren when they first met.
Stallone described Lundgren as 'the real Terminator,' citing his imposing physique and chiseled features. 'He was just too good looking—too perfect,' Stallone said. 'And if I loathe him, I'm sure the world will.'
Stallone was on the hunt for a villainous character in Rocky IV and wanted someone who embodied a 'big, horrible, vicious guy.' Lundgren's 6'5 frame and wide shoulders made him an ideal fit for the role of Drago. Stallone even joked about Lundgren's 'proceeding hairline,' saying, 'He looks like a guy from 1,000 years in the future. This is not a guy you see waiting on your table.'
Despite their rocky start, Stallone and Lundgren have become close friends and collaborators. They are reportedly working on a new project, The International, and may even star in a new Expendables film. Neither project has an announced release date.
